MILWAUKEE, WISCONSIN SOCIAL SERVICE ORGANIZATION IS LOOKING FOR A CAREER CASE MANAGER FOR THEIR WORKFORCE DEVELOPMENT OFFICE. THIS IS A TEMP TO PERM POSITION PAYING IN THE MID to UPPER 20'S AN HOUR FIRST AS TEMP AND UP TO $55,000 WHEN CONVERTED TO PERMANENT. THIS IS NOT A REMOTE POSITION BUT IN PERSON.
Duties and Responsibilities:
· Administer intake services and assessments
Experience with clients with mental health needs, especially someone who can do Mental Health Assessments
· Identify participant strengths and barriers to employment
· Guide participants through the formation of short-term and long-term goals and how they will be achieved
· Manage participant referrals to supportive service providers
· Work with participants to ensure they are progressing toward their goals written in their IEP
· Maintain consistent communication with enrolled participants
· Consistently report participant activities and conversations in Salesforce and DOP’s on-line data management system
· Submit a weekly report to the Program Manager
Provide retention services to participants
Requirements:
· Minimum Bachelor’s Degree, at least two (2) years of relevant experience, or a graduate degree with one (1) year of experience in workforce development or social services
